Location: Trafford Park
Hours: 10:00pm – 7:30am, Monday to Friday
Pay Rate: £13.70 per hour
Contract Type: Temporary to Permanent
About The Role
We are currently recruiting for a FLT Driver/Night Warehouse Operative based in Trafford Park. This is an excellent opportunity for someone looking for long-term, stable night shift work with the potential to secure a permanent position.
Responsibilities
- Loading and unloading goods using manual pallet trucks (physical work required)
- Moving stock safely and efficiently within the warehouse
- Ensuring all products are handled with care and accuracy
- Maintaining a clean, organised, and safe working environment
- Following all health and safety procedures at all times
Requirements
- Must be physically fit, as the role involves manual handling and movement of stock
- Previous experience in a warehouse or distribution environment is preferred
- Valid FLT Counterbalance licence
- Reliable, punctual, and able to work well as part of a team
Benefits
- Competitive pay rate of £13.70 per hour
- Night shift, Monday to Friday
- Opportunity for long-term employment and progression
- Supportive and friendly working environment
